Kylie Jenner is facing a lawsuit from a former housekeeper, Angelica Hernandez Vasquez, who alleges she was subjected to a "toxic and abusive environment" during her employment from September 2024 to August 2025. The lawsuit, filed in Los Angeles, claims Vasquez experienced "severe and pervasive harassment" and discrimination based on her race, national origin, and religion from senior household staff, including a head housekeeper identified as Patsy and a supervisor named Elsi.

According to court documents, Vasquez reported being treated with "hostility and exclusion" from her first day. She alleges she was routinely assigned the most difficult tasks, publicly belittled, had her accent mocked, and was subjected to demeaning treatment. The complaint also states that supervisors allegedly snapped their fingers at her, demanded to inspect her phone, made derogatory remarks about her Catholic faith and Salvadoran background, and even made comments related to deportation.

Vasquez claims that in March 2025, a supervisor allegedly threw hangers at her feet while reprimanding her. She also alleges that her complaints about the mistreatment were ignored, dismissed, or mocked, and that her working conditions worsened, including reduced hours and an increased workload. This alleged hostile environment led Vasquez to take medical leave in July 2025, and she ultimately resigned in August 2025, citing anxiety, severe stress, and symptoms consistent with post-traumatic stress disorder.

The lawsuit names Kylie Jenner Inc., Tri Star Services, and La Maison Family Services as defendants. While Jenner is not directly accused of engaging in the harassing behavior, the suit contends she is liable for failing to intervene or address the reported conduct. Vasquez is seeking a jury trial and damages for unpaid wages, meal and rest period premium pay, unreimbursed business expenses, unpaid sick leave, and other compensation she claims was unlawfully withheld. This is not the first time a member of the Kardashian-Jenner family has faced legal action from former staff; Kim Kardashian was sued by domestic staff in 2021 over similar wage and break violations.

Representatives for Kylie Jenner have not yet publicly commented on the allegations.
